Output 32f633e35de62e789681a3f715fb7fdb98ee0d277de7b45b3c0b83035d09a41f:28

value
209289
script pubkey
OP_0 OP_PUSHBYTES_20 f18c90c00c2fc797a409dd886f00cd5b109b6ca4
address
bc1q7xxfpsqv9lre0fqfmkyx7qxdtvgfkm9ygckkxk
transaction
32f633e35de62e789681a3f715fb7fdb98ee0d277de7b45b3c0b83035d09a41f
confirmations
135756
spent
true